J. Goldman & Co's Q4 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2017, J. Goldman & Co held 502 positions worth $1.91B, down 3.9% from $1.98B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

J. Goldman & Co withdrew a net $132M in Q4 2017, closing 186 positions and reducing 71 holdings. Its most notable exit was B&G Foods, an estimated $27.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 12% of assets, up from 7.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, J. Goldman & Co opened a new position in Knight Transportation worth $24.9M.
